golf43,

 

We did park at the pier @ $12 per night. Since you are doing the four night cruise, you might consider a local hotel with complimentary cruise parking & shuttle (and some even have breakfast). Here is a list for you (but confirm the arrangements at booking):

 

Parking & Shuttle:

http://www.radisson.com/capecanaveralfl

http://www.bestwesterncocoabeach.com (shuttle is comp for two only)

http://www.daysinncocoabeach.com (shuttle is comp for two only)

Hilton Cocoa Beach Oceanfront 321-799-0003

 

Parking, shuttle & breakfast:

http://www.theinnatcocoabeach.com

http://www.clarionspacecoast.com

http://www.qualitysuitescocoabeach.com

http://www.comfortinncocoabeach.com

 

 

Parking & breakfast (pay for shuttle)

http://www.hamptoninncocoabeach.com

Econo Lodge Space Center 321-632-4561
